The interfaceshould be ashonest as thework.

Field operators read screens in PPE on noisy floors. They have ten seconds at the kettle, three taps before a glove rejects the touch, one shot at a status that's either true or it isn't. The decoration we love most as designers — gradients, glassmorphism, soft motion, color used for mood — fails them silently.

This system removes those things. What remains is type compressed to the edge of legibility, a single green that means something every time it appears, and shadows instead of borders so the geometry stays clean. There is no magic. There is alignment with what the work actually demands.
